    The game is a fun remake of the original generation of pokemon. However they removed the random pokemon battles, added in a co-op mode, and made the game significantly easier.

    This game is awesome for beginners and some veterans because of its approachability and level of difficulty. Let's Go Eevee is basically Pokemon Red, Blue. and Yellow remastered in 1080p in addition to tweaking a few core elements such as no more wild battles and the use of Secret Techniques instead of HMs.
